V-CUBE Solution Step 2: Matching Edge Groups

In the examples below, we will be solving the orange/blue edge group. These two ideas are the basis for almost all of the edge pairing in the examples below. See if you can break down a couple example groups into their setup, join, store, and restore sections for each piece or group of pieces.


edge pairing alg: A R U R' A'

In this alg, 'A' is any single (or multiple) horizontal slices between Up and Down layers. In the single edge example A would be the 2U slice. The idea is to pair the pieces up, remove them from the 'working' layer, then restore our centers. Notice in the setup, that our edge to be matched is placed across from our started edge, but flipped.

Also, you can match up multiple pieces as long as the centers are correctly restored. In the multiple edges position we are able to match up two edges instead of just one, using the correct setup moves before we shoot the group out. Here A would equal the d and u slices, and the alg to match all of them up would be: (d u) R U R' (d' u'). At first, it can be difficult to find what you're looking for but as you get further into the solve location becomes easier. Since you have already paired up groups you have reduced the possibilities for leftover pieces to look through. You can click on either picture to watch the alg performed.

Example continued

As shown above, we will now be pairing up groups of edges pieces in our example. There are 12 groups of edges, each consisting of four pieces. We will match them up piece by piece until we have completed an entire group, and then store that group on the Up or Down face of the cube. Sometimes everything will work out, but more often than not there is extra work at the end of matching things up to complete all the edge groups. The description will walk you through the first couple builds, but gives less detail as it goes along. Anything not shown is for the reader to figure out as an exercise. Since you know what color group is being fixed, it should be easy for you to follow what's going on. Also, notice how the green/yellow and blue/red group are intentionally paired up with the outside edges swapped.


Edges:

Blue/Black: F2 U F u2 d R' U R u2 d'
The F2 puts the blue/black piece in the bottom so we can do the U move to place another blue/black piece across from it. F puts both of these in the middle slice so all 4 pieces are set up in the middle layers. Notice how the rest of the alg is almost exactly the same forward as it is backwards. u2 d align the top and bottom blue/black piece with the pair of blue/blacks on the back face. R' U R pulls the fixed group out of the build layer and replaces it with an unfixed edge. u2 d' restores our centers back to the solve position, and now you should have a blue/black group in the back of the top face.

Orange/Black: R U2 R' u' 3D2 R U' R' u 3D2
Here R U2 R' grabs the black oranges in the Up layer and brings them opposite of the black/orange on the FL border. u' and 3D2 match up the 4 pieces, then R U' R shoots the group up into the top layer. Finally, u and 3D2 restore our centers.

Red/Black: F2 u' R U2 R'3D'L' U' L u 3D U'F D L' 3U' R U' R' 3U
This one is a bit more cumbersome. We're forced to do just 3 pieces, then reset and position to get our final piece in.

The rest of the edge groups are shown below:
Red/Yellow: R2 u L' U L u' F'L 3D' L'U L 3D B d L U' L' d'
Orange/Yellow: R U2 R' 3D' L' U' L F' L F L' 3D D R d' L' U L d
Green/Black: R U' R' d 3d2 L' U' L d' 3d2 F' R 3D' L' U L 3D
Blue/Yellow: x2 L U R U' R' d 3d R' U2 R d' 3d'
Green/Yellow: R 3d2 L' U' L F' L F L' 3d2 (swapped wings)
Blue/Red: y2 D2 R u 3D' F U' F' u' 3D (swapped wings)
Blue/Orange: L2 3D2 R U2 R' 3D2 L R2 3D2 U' L' U L 3D2
Orange/Green: R2 u' R U R' F R' F' R u
Fix 2 parity groups: U2 R' u' d R U R' F R' F' R u d'

Take special notice that we have stored the Green/Yellow group in BR and it still has the wings swapped.
